The Monastery of St. Nino in Matkhoji

Colchis Lowland – this historical place, beautifully illuminated by the rays of the setting sun, unfolds in front of you in the form of a beautiful panoramic view from the curved hill of Imereti. There is a nunnery named after St. Nino and a small church built of white stone hidden in the greenery. The monastery was founded in 1893, on the ruins of the church built in the 16th century. During the communist era, the service was temporarily suspended. For relaxation and familiarization with monastic life, you can visit the nuns of the monastery at any time. Nuns are engaged in organic agriculture and they keep livestock. Traditional handicrafts, icon painting and others are taught.

Note that in the yard you may meet a large Georgian shepherd who lives in the monastery, but is not aggressive towards people.
